Special Marine Warning
National Weather Service Brownsville TX
857 PM CDT Sat May 10 2025

The National Weather Service in Brownsville has issued a

* Special Marine Warning for...
  Coastal waters from Baffin Bay to Port Mansfield TX out 20 NM...
  Waters from Baffin Bay to Port Mansfield TX from 20 to 60 NM...

* Until 930 PM CDT.

* At 857 PM CDT, strong thunderstorms were located along a line
  extending from 28 nm southeast of Malaquite Beach to 29 nm
  northeast of Laguna Madre, moving southeast at 30 knots.

  HAZARD...Wind gusts 34 knots or greater and small hail.

  SOURCE...Radar.

  IMPACT...Small craft could be damaged in briefly higher winds and
           suddenly higher waves.

* Strong thunderstorms will remain over mainly open waters.

P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...

Move to safe harbor until hazardous weather passes.

Boaters should seek safe harbor immediately until these storms pass.
Wind gusts 34 knots or greater, small hail, high waves, dangerous
lightning, and heavy rain are possible with these storms.
